In this study, a novel P2-type sodium manganese oxide is presented using a facile preparation method. With the help of titanium doping, and introduction of interstitial water, the electrochemical performances of as-prepared nanosized material are greatly improved. Redox titration results indicate that a small amount substitution of Mn with Ti increases the manganese valance state, and an extended solid solution zone is observed in the initial charge-discharge curves. Electrochemical impedance spectroscopy results manifest that the charge transfer resistance is greatly reduced, and sodium ion diffusion is improved. The performance modulation in this work highlights the synergetic effect for the material design.
